Bitcoin’s Path to Stability and Potential Rally

After a tumultuous period that saw Bitcoin’s price surge to nearly $50,000 before plummeting below $40,000, the cryptocurrency has found solid ground. The approval of spot Bitcoin ETFs in the United States last month was a pivotal moment, leading to increased inflows from these new exchange-traded funds. With the price now consolidating around the $51K-$52K level, many industry experts believe this could be the precursor to a major rally. The upcoming Bitcoin halving in April, an event known to have bullish implications, is expected to further fuel this potential surge by reducing the reward for mining new blocks, thus slashing Bitcoin’s inflation rate in half.

Ripple’s legal entanglements with the SEC have been a focal point in the cryptocurrency community. The lawsuit, which began over three years ago, revolves around allegations that Ripple conducted an unregistered securities offering through its sale of XRP. Despite these challenges, Ripple has managed to secure three partial court victories in 2023, suggesting a possible advantage in the ongoing dispute. However, the battle is far from over, with a grand trial scheduled for April 23 and a crucial deadline for the discovery phase focused on “remedies” related to XRP sales looming on February 20.

The Rise of Solana Meme Coins

The resurgence of meme coins within the Solana ecosystem has been noteworthy. Dogwifhat (WIF) has seen an impressive performance, reaching an all-time high of over $0.45 and experiencing an 80% increase in the past 14 days. Other coins like Bonk Inu (BONK) and Myro (MYRO) have also seen gains, though more modest in comparison. This trend highlights the continued interest and speculative investment in meme coins, which remain a volatile yet intriguing aspect of the cryptocurrency market.
